How Much Does It Cost to Start a Peanut Farm?
# Startup Cost Description Min Amount Max Amount
1 Real Estate & Land Costs Costs for land purchase/lease, deposits, site preparation, appraisal fees and zoning compliance. $3,000 $8,000
2 Farming Equipment & Machinery Includes tractors, planters, harvesters and maintenance contracts with new purchase or lease options. $50,000 $150,000
3 Irrigation Systems & Infrastructure Covers drip and pivot systems, installation costs, and infrastructure enhancements like storage sheds. $550 $1,725
4 Licenses, Permits, and Insurance Encompasses agricultural permits, crop and liability insurance, inspections and certification fees. $4,500 $15,000
5 Initial Inputs & Agricultural Supplies Involves quality seeds, fertilizers, pesticides, storage and handling costs with bulk purchase discounts. $5,000 $10,000
6 Staffing & Operational Setup Covers labor costs, training programs, seasonal hiring and management expenses. $30,000 $60,000
7 Marketing & Direct Sales Channels Includes branding, website development, online marketing, expos, packaging design and PR initiatives. $5,000 $13,000
Total $98,050 $257,725

Startup Cost 2: Farming Equipment & Machinery


Farming equipment and machinery represent a significant portion of your peanut farming startup costs, typically accounting for 40–50% of your initial capital investment. This expense is crucial as it directly impacts your operational efficiency and productivity. With new equipment costs ranging from $50,000 to $150,000 per unit, understanding your options is essential for effective budgeting.


Key Cost Drivers

The primary cost drivers for farming equipment include the type of machinery needed, whether you choose to buy new or used, and the associated maintenance contracts. Additionally, leasing options can significantly reduce upfront costs.

Factors Affecting Cost

  • Type of machinery required for peanut farming
  • New vs. refurbished equipment choices
  • Leasing vs. purchasing equipment
  • Maintenance and operational efficiency improvements

Farming Equipment & Machinery Cost Breakdown


Expense Component Estimated Cost Notes
Tractors $50,000 - $150,000 Essential for land preparation and harvesting
Planters $20,000 - $50,000 Critical for efficient planting
Harvesters $30,000 - $100,000 Necessary for timely harvesting
Maintenance Contracts 5–7% of equipment value annually Helps avoid unexpected repair costs


Startup Cost 3: Irrigation Systems & Infrastructure


Investing in irrigation systems and infrastructure is crucial for the success of your peanut farming venture. Effective irrigation not only ensures optimal growth but also significantly impacts your overall peanut farming expenses. With costs ranging from $500 to $1,500 per acre for drip and pivot irrigation systems, understanding these expenses is essential for accurate budgeting.


Primary Cost Drivers

The main cost drivers for irrigation systems and infrastructure include the type of system you choose, installation expenses, and ongoing maintenance. Automated systems can enhance efficiency but may increase initial costs by 12–18%.

Factors Affecting Cost

  • Type of irrigation system selected (drip vs. pivot)
  • Installation complexity and labor costs
  • Soil quality and water availability
  • Regulatory compliance and zoning requirements

Irrigation Systems & Infrastructure Cost Breakdown


Expense Component Estimated Cost Notes
Drip Irrigation System $500 - $1,500 Cost per acre, depending on system type
Pivot Irrigation System $1,000 - $1,500 Higher initial investment, but efficient
Installation Costs 10–15% of equipment cost Labor and materials for setup
Infrastructure Enhancements Varies Storage sheds and processing areas
